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
Beat butter and sugar on medium speed until light and fluffy, about 2–3 minutes. Add eggs and vanilla; mix until combined.
In a separate bowl, whisk flour, baking soda, cream of tartar, and salt. Add to the butter mixture on medium-low speed until a dough forms.
Fold in the sprinkles with a spatula.
Divide dough into 4 portions. Leave one plain; color the others pink, blue, and violet with gel food coloring.
Combine all doughs in one bowl and swirl gently - just 3–4 folds. Stop before the colors blend completely!
Scoop into balls and roll in granulated sugar. Place 2 inches apart on the baking sheet.
Bake 10–12 minutes until edges are just set. Cool on the pan for 5 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ack.
